How does telehealth benefit rural patients?
Telehealth provides rural patients with access to specialist care without the need for extensive travel, reducing both time and cost while ensuring they receive timely and effective treatment.
What role does EHR play in patient care?
EHR systems enhance the accuracy and availability of patient records, allowing healthcare providers to make informed decisions and deliver better-coordinated care, which ultimately improves patient outcomes.
